A new geometry-based stochastic scattering model (GBSSM) for wideband multiple-input–multiple-output vehicle-to-vehicle (V2V) channels is proposed in this paper. The proposed GBSSM with cross-polarized antennas combines three-dimensional two cylinders to model the stationary scatterers and two-dimensional multirings to imitate the moving scatterers. In this paper, a non-stationary geometry-based scattering model for street wideband multi-input multi-output (MIMO) vehicle-to-vehicle (V2V) fading channel is proposed. It is assumed that the static scatterers on the both roadside are uniformly distributed on time-varying ellipses, and the mobile scatterers are uniformly distributed in time-varying segment of the road.
